En skrivbordsanvändare kan skriva ut filer på flera olika sätt. De olika förfaringssätten kan delas in i två huvudkategorier: utskrifter från skrivbordet och från ett program.
Du kan skriva ut från skrivbordet genom att:
Markera en fil i filhanteraren och välja Skriv ut från Markera-menyn eller ikonens meny
Dra en fil från filhanteraren till huvudgruppens skrivarikon eller panelundermenyn Egen skrivare
Dra en fil från filhanteraren till en skrivare i utskriftshanterarens huvudfönster
Om du vill skriva ut från ett program använder du kommandot Skriv ut, som normalt finns på en meny eller nås via en ikon i programfönstret.
I det här avsnittet beskrivs hur du lägger till och tar bort skrivare från skrivbordet.
Lägg till en skrivare till systemets konfiguration.
Följ instruktionerna i dokumentationen för systemadministratörer för operativsystemet.
Kör kommandot:
env LANG=språk /usr/dt/bin/dtprintinfo -populate
Starta om utskriftshanteraren genom att dubbelklicka på Ladda om åtgärder i programgruppen Skrivbordsverktyg i programhanteraren. Kontrollera att skrivaren visas.
Skicka ett meddelande till användarna att även de ska starta om utskriftshanteraren och köra Ladda om åtgärder.
Varje gång utskriftshanteraren anropas läser den systemets skrivarkonfigurationslista. Om en ny skrivare upptäcks skapas automatiskt en ny skrivaråtgärd och ikon för skrivaren till skrivbordet. Du behöver inte göra något mer för att skrivaren ska visas på skrivbordet.
Ta bort skrivaren från systemkonfigurationen.
Följ instruktionerna i dokumentationen för systemadministratörer för operativsystemet.
Starta om utskriftshanteraren genom att dubbelklicka på Ladda om åtgärder i programgruppen Skrivbordsverktyg i programhanteraren. Kontrollera att skrivaren är borta.
Skicka ett meddelande till användarna att även de ska starta om utskriftshanteraren och köra Ladda om åtgärder.
Varje gång utskriftshanteraren anropas läser den systemets skrivarkonfigurationslista. Om den upptäcker att en skrivare har tagits bort från listan, tas skrivarens åtgärd och ikon automatiskt bort från utskriftshanteraren och filhanteraren. Du behöver inte göra något mer för att ta bort skrivaren från skrivbordet.
Utskriftshanteraren kan inte ta bort skrivare från huvudgruppen. Därför ska du skicka ett meddelande till alla användare när du tar bort en skrivare, så att de tar bort alla ikoner för den skrivaren på huvudgruppen.
Om du vill ändra hur ofta informationen i utskriftshanteraren ska uppdateras, ändrar du intervallet för jobbuppdatering. Normalt begär utskriftshanteraren information om utskriftsjobb från skrivaren var 30:e sekund. Du ändrar detta med skjutreglaget Uppdatera intervall i dialogrutan Välj alternativ (visas när du väljer Välj alternativ på Visa-menyn).
När du lägger till en skrivare tilldelas den automatiskt standardskrivarikonen. Om du vill göra en annan ikon tillgänglig placerar du ikonfilerna i /etc/dt/appconfig/icons/språk eller i någon annan katalog i ikonsökvägen. Användarna kan sedan markera den här ikonen för att ersätta standardikonen.
Du måste skapa en komplett uppsättning (mycket liten, normal och stor) ikoner, annars visas de inte i ikonväljaren i utskriftshanteraren.
Mer information om ikonsökvägen finns i "Ikonsökväg".
Ikonernas filnamn ska se ut så här:
basnamn.storlek.typ
där:
storlek - l (stor), m (normal), t (pytteliten). Mer information om ikonstorlekar finns i "Storlekskonventioner".
typ - pm (färgbildpunktsbeskrivning), bm (bitmapp).
Ikonfilnamnet på en medelstor respektive en mycket liten ikon för en färgskrivare blir då ColorPrinter.m.pm och ColorPrinter.t.pm.
Mer information om hur du skapar ikoner finns i Kapitel 14.
Du ska ändra de globala skrivaregenskaperna så fort du har lagt till skrivaren, innan användarna har ändrat dem med utskrifthanteraren. När användarna väl har ändrat skrivaregenskaper med utskriftshanteraren visas inte de ändringar som du gör.
Redigera filen /etc/dt/appconfig/types/språk/utskriftskö.dt med önskad information om ikon, skrivarnamn och beskrivning:
I fältet ICON uppdaterar du basnamn till den nya ikonens basnamn.
I fältet LABEL uppdaterar du etikettnamn till det nya skrivarnamnet.
Uppdatera texten i fältet DESCRIPTION.
Här kan du skriva var skrivaren finns, typen av skrivare och skrivarkontakter. Om du vill skriva mer än en rad, placerar du ett \ i slutet av raden. Till exempel:
DESCRIPTION Det här är en PostScript-skrivare i byggnad 1, \ rum 123. Ring 555-5555 om du har problem.
Standardskrivaren används när användaren:
Släpper ett objekt på skrivarikonen på huvudgruppen
Markerar ett objekt i filhanteraren sedan väljer Skriv ut från vald meny eller från ikonens objektmeny
Skriver ut från program som använder standardskrivare
Så här ändrar du standardskrivare för alla användare:
Öppna filen /etc/dt/config/Xsession.d/0010.dtpaths.
Om /etc/dt/config/Xsession.d/0010.dtpaths inte finns kopierar du den från /usr/dt/config/Xsession.d/0010.dtpaths.
I fältet LPDEST=skrivare uppdaterar du skrivare till den nya destinationen för standardutskrift.
Om raden inte finns lägger du till raden LPDEST=skrivare, där skrivare är namnet på skrivaren som ska vara standardskrivare.
Användarna måste logga ut och in igen.
Så här ändrar en enstaka användare standardskrivare:
Kopiera en annan skrivare till huvudgruppen från panelundermenyn Egen skrivare.
Om du vill ändra standardskrivaren för en enskild användare måste du:
Gå till hemmappen och öppna filen .dtprofile.
Lägg till eller redigera en rad som anger värden för omgivningsvariabeln LPDEST
:
LPDEST=skrivarenhet; export LPDEST
Om du använder csh är syntaxen:
setenv LPDEST skrivarenhet
Följande rad ändrar t ex standardskrivaren till den skrivare vars enhetsnamn är laser3d.
LPDEST=laser3d; export LPDEST
Om du använder csh är syntaxen:
setenv LPDEST laser3d
När en utskriftsbegäran initieras av att en fil släpps på skrivarikonen, utför systemet följande:
Systemet söker i datatypsdatabasen efter det släppta objektets definition.
Om det finns en unik skrivaråtgärd för datatypen (anges med fältet ARG_TYPE i utskriftsåtgärden) används den, annars används standardutskriftsåtgärden (dtlp). Om t ex filen är en PostScript\256-fil, använder systemet Print-åtgärden för PostScript-filer. Den här åtgärden definieras i /usr/dt/appconfig/types/språk/dt.dt. Om du använde verktyget Skapa åtgärd för den här datatypen, används det utskriftskommando du angav som utskriftsåtgärd för att skriva ut filer av den här typen.
Filen levereras till skrivaren med det vanliga UNIX-undersystemet lp för utskrift.